Understanding Trust Administration

Trust administration is the process of managing a trust’s assets, obligations, and distributions according to the trust document and state law.

This work often involves inventory, beneficiary communications, accounting, taxes, and coordinating with financial institutions.

Definition and Explanation

In California, a trust is a fiduciary arrangement that appoints a trustee to manage assets and carry out the grantor’s instructions for beneficiaries.

Key Elements and Processes

Key elements include identifying assets, funding the trust, ongoing administration, accounting, tax reporting, and final distributions according to the trust terms.

Key Terms and Glossary

This glossary defines important terms such as trustee, beneficiary, fiduciary duty, and funding.

Trustee

The person or institution named to manage trust assets and carry out the grantor’s instructions.

Beneficiaries

Individuals or organizations designated to receive trust assets.

Fiduciary Duty

A legal obligation to act in the best interests of beneficiaries and maintain prudent management.

Funding

The process of transferring assets into the trust so they can be managed and distributed as directed.

What is trust administration and who needs it?

Trust administration involves overseeing the terms of a trust after it is created, including asset management, distributions, and ongoing compliance. A trustee or successor trustee handles these duties under California law and the trust document. If you are responsible for managing a trust, you may benefit from clear guidance and practical steps to stay organized and compliant.

In California, a trustee can be named in the trust or appointed by the court if necessary. A trusted family member, a professional fiduciary, or a financial institution can serve as trustee. It is important to choose someone who is capable, impartial, and willing to fulfill fiduciary responsibilities.

The timeline for trust administration varies with the complexity of the trust, the number of assets, and any issues among beneficiaries. Simple matters can take months, while complex situations may take longer. We work to establish a realistic schedule and keep you informed.

Common documents include the trust instrument, death certificate if applicable, asset lists, bank statements, and information about beneficiaries and creditors. Our team can help you assemble what is needed.

Yes. Beneficiaries have the right to receive information about the trust, including accounting and distributions. We help facilitate communication and provide clear, timely updates.

If a trust is underfunded, distributions may be delayed or legally challenged. Proper funding before or during administration helps ensure the terms are honored and reduces disputes.

Trust administration guides asset management and distributions without the level of court involvement typical with probate. However, some probate issues may arise if the trust terms are unclear or disputed.
